Ancestors Dirks - Fijnaut » Lisbeth Lenarts (1659-1726)

Personal data Lisbeth Lenarts 

  • Also known as Lenaertz.
  • She was christened on April 9, 1659 in Millen (D).Source 1
    Geloof: r.k.
    (achternaam moeder niet vermeld)
    Witnesses: Andreas Quix,
  • She died on March 13, 1726 in Schinnen (Sweikhuizen).Source 2
    (Elisabetha Lienärt e.v. Joannes Baggen ex Schweikhuijss)
  • This information was last updated on August 19, 2018.

Household of Lisbeth Lenarts

She is married to Joannes Baggen.

They got married about 1688.Source 3

Kinderen waarschijnlijk te Wehr?

Child(ren):

  1. Bartholomaeus Baggen  ± 1690-1769
  2. Anna Baggen  ± 1693-????
  3. Christina Baggen  ± 1695-1728
  4. Catharina Baggen  ± 1697-1698
  5. Catharina Baggen  1699-1748
  6. Maria Baggen  ± 1702-1703
